The THOMAS BETTS 8621 is a straight compression conduit connector designed for use with rigid metal conduit (RMC) and intermediate metal conduit (IMC) in non-hazardous electrical installations. Constructed from malleable iron, this connector provides a secure, non-insulated mechanical connection between conduit and an enclosure or junction box knockout. The compression-style fitting delivers a reliable, tool-assisted termination that maintains conduit continuity and supports proper grounding paths. At a 2-inch trade size, it suits medium and larger conduit runs commonly found in commercial and industrial wiring systems. This connector is suited for non-hazardous area installations where rigid or IMC conduit terminates at enclosures, panels, junction boxes, or other electrical equipment. It is appropriate for both new construction and retrofit work in commercial, industrial, and utility applications where a 2-inch trade size conduit system is specified. The straight configuration simplifies termination at flat enclosure surfaces without requiring additional fittings or adapters.

Installation should be performed by a licensed electrician in accordance with the National Electrical Code (NEC) and applicable local codes. De-energize and lock out the panel or enclosure before beginning conduit termination work. The compression fitting requires the appropriate compression tool or wrench to properly seat the connector body and ensure a secure mechanical and electrical connection. Do not overtighten, as malleable iron fittings can crack under excessive force.
